AI Evaluation of COVID-19 Sounds

In this study the investigators record sounds of voice, breaths and cough of subjects who tested positive for COVID19. The investigators then feed these sounds into an artificial intelligence and see if it can learn to recognise features to make COVID19 diagnosis from these sounds in order to avoid to use swabs to test the general population.

Study Population

Study participants from the general population meeting the inclusion criteria will be included in three cohorts:

  1. SARS-CoV-2 positive
  2. SARS-CoV-2 negative but with respiratory disease
  3. Healthy volunteers

Description

Inclusion Criteria:

  • Adults who tested positive for SARS-CoV-2 currently admitted to hospital at the study site
  • Adults who tested negative for SARS-CoV-2 and are admitted for any respiratory condition (eg COPD or asthma flare-up, pneumonia..)
  • Healthy volunteers

Exclusion Criteria:

  • Patients under the age of 18.
  • Patients unable to read in Italian.
  • Patients unable to give informed consent to participate.
  • Patients requiring life support (including, but not limited to, mechanical cardiac support, ventilation, etc.)
  • Patients who are pregnant
